Mission:
The mission of KOLAGE is to foster an equitable work environment where GLBT employees can feel a sense of security and community within the Coca-Cola Corporation. This will enable GLBT employees to work free of fears and distractions, which in turn will allow them to focus on increasing shareowner value.
Vision:
KOLAGE envisions a global Coca-Cola system that ensures GLBT employees of their basic equal rights--A system where GLBT employees can be open, honest, and safe at work, at home, and in the community.
We strive for a system where associates can participate fully without fear of loss of opportunity--A system that allows GLBT employees full realization of their potential and equal participation in all aspects of corporate life.
Goals:
To foster a safe and supportive environment within The Coca-Cola Company for employees who are gay, lesbian, bisexual, transgender, or their allies.
To provide a professional and social network to employees of The Coca-Cola Company.
To provide support and assistance to employees who wish to "come out" in the work place.
To serve as a resource to Coca-Cola management and other functional groups on GLBT issues.
To encourage and assist The Coca-Cola Company in its efforts to achieve greater market share among GLBT consumers.
To promote the participation of openly GLBT employees at company sponsored community service activities, and to support representation of The Coca-Cola Company at GLBT community activities and community service events.
To use our visibility as a tool to educate other Coca-Cola employees about GLBT issues.
To advocate for the business value of diversity within the workforce.
To work with other GLBT employee associations to enhance the overall image of GLBT employees within corporate culture.
To ensure that The Coca-Cola Company's policy and practice of hiring, training, and promoting the best-qualified individuals continues without regard to sexual orientation.
To promote understanding of the workplace-related concerns and sensitivities of GLBT people at The Coca-Cola Company.
Membership:
KOLAGE belongs to and reflects the desires of its members. Membership is available to all associates within the Coca-Cola system, without regard to sexual orientation.

Because some of the gay, lesbian, bisexual, and transgender members of KOLAGE may not feel comfortable being "out" in the workplace, membership lists remain private. Only Robert and Nancy will have access to the membership lists.
All members agree to respect and maintain the privacy of other members in our organization.

A Steering Committee manages KOLAGE. It is composed of volunteer members who serve at will. When a vacancy occurs, the remaining members will either choose a replacement or provide a means for the membership to elect someone to fill the vacancy.
The purpose of the steering committee is to provide direction and ensure focus for achieving the goals of KOLAGE.
